Transaction 75b55e1ece941413edac6a2cd0a727ce1eb261ae5718a1e51cb6f103fa6f8606
1 Input
1 Output
-
75b55e1ece941413edac6a2cd0a727ce1eb261ae5718a1e51cb6f103fa6f8606:0
- value
- 6518256
- script pubkey
- OP_0 OP_PUSHBYTES_20 374187d7ebe0c4ec0bb314030ddcfaff3ca3a34a
- address
- bc1qxaqc04lturzwczanzspsmh86lu728g62xjl86s